Abstract

The invention discloses a method for measuring the content of a plumbum element in soil with an ICP (inductively coupled plasma) method. An ICP-AES (atomic emission spectrometry) method is used for measuring the content of plumbum in a soil sample. The method comprises the steps as follows: a certain amount of a hydrofluoric acid solution is added to a lead-bearing sample in the soil, then high-concentration nitric acid and high-concentration sulfuric acid are added, and then microwave digestion is performed; and high-temperature digestion is performed in a focus digestion tank, then an ICP-AES spectrograph is used for measuring the content of plumbum, and during measurement, experiment parameters are chosen reasonably according to requirements of an experiment, so that the content of plumbum in the soil sample can be measured more conveniently, rapidly and accurately. The detection limit of the method is 0.15 mu g/mL, and requirements of production and living can be met.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the field of environmental element measurement, in particular to the measurement of lead element in soil by ICP plasma atomic emission spectrometry. Background technique [0002] Lead in soil is mainly Pb(OH) 2 , PbCO 3 , PbSO 4 Existing in solid form, lead is a poisonous blue-gray metal. It often enters the human body through contaminated food and respiratory tracts in the form of vapors, dust and compounds. Plants absorb soluble lead in the soil through the root system, especially tomato, potato, radish, barley, corn, tobacco, etc., which are susceptible to negative pollution, and accumulate in the root. Fish, clams, and clams can accumulate lead from sludge, and the lead concentration in their bodies can be 1,000 times higher than that in water bodies.
